Barnes supporter arrested

GAINESVILLE - A Roy Barnes supporter says he has hired a lawyer following his arrest for carrying a campaign sign at Mule Camp Market in downtown Gainesville.

Larry Gibson was arrested during the festival after he refused to stop displaying the "Roy Barnes for Governor" sign at the Gainesville Jaycees-sponsored event. Gainesville Police Lt. Carol Martin said the Jaycees were within their rights to keep politics out of the festival.

"State law criminal trespass was explained to Mr. Gibson and again they asked him to leave, and he refused to leave the area," said Lt. Martin. "He told them [the police] that we could take him to jail."

Lt. Martin said a man carrying a Republican sign was asked to leave the day before and he did so.
